isc Silicon NPN Power Transistor 2SD2060 DESCRIPTION ·Collector-Emitter Breakdown Voltage- : V(BR)CEO= 80V(Min) ·Collector Power Dissipation- : PC= 25W@ TC= 25℃ ·Low Collector Saturation Voltage- : VCE(sat)= 1.7V(Max)@ (IC= 3A, IB= 0.3A) ·Complement to Type 2SB1368 ·Minimum Lot-to-Lot variations for robust device performance and reliable operation APPLICATIONS ·Designed for general purpose applications.
